National Black Data Processing Associates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 690,423 | 851,195 | −160,772 | -1.6 | 0% |
| 2012 | 697,570 | 651,424 | 46,146 | -1.3 | 0% |
| 2013 | 686,037 | 665,305 | 20,732 | -0.7 | 0% |
| 2014 | 585,473 | 684,910 | −99,437 | -2.4 | 0% |
| 2015 | 675,456 | 661,145 | 14,311 | -2.2 | 0% |
| 2016 | 650,999 | 675,852 | −24,853 | -2.6 | 0% |
| 2017 | 504,297 | 552,931 | −48,634 | -4.3 | 0% |
| 2018 | 539,963 | 410,513 | 129,450 | -2.0 | 0% |
| 2019 | 419,324 | 490,427 | −71,103 | -3.4 | 0% |
| 2020 | 286,336 | 92,454 | 193,882 | 7.1 | 0% |
| 2021 | 273,412 | 170,109 | 103,303 | 11.2 | 0% |
| 2022 | 362,673 | 464,316 | −101,643 | 1.5 | 0% |
In its most recent public year (2022), this organization spent $101,643 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 1.5 months of spending, up from -1.6 in 2011. Staff pay was 0%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2022.
